Plug Types Used in India

The most widely used international plug. Two round parallel pins. Used throughout continental Europe and many other countries.

Configuration: 2 round parallel pins
Typical Voltage: 220-240V

Type D

Grounded

Three large round pins in a triangular pattern. Mainly used in India, Nepal, and parts of Africa.

Configuration: 3 large round pins (triangular)
Typical Voltage: 220-240V

Travel Tips for India

Voltage Compatibility: India uses 230V voltage. This is higher voltage. Devices from 100-120V countries will need a voltage converter unless they support dual voltage (100-240V).

Adapter Needed: You'll need a Type C or Type D adapter to plug in your devices if your plugs don't match these types.

Frequency: The electrical frequency is 50Hz. Most electronics can handle both 50Hz and 60Hz, but some clocks and motors may run differently.
